The Virginia Tech College of Architecture and Urban Studies presents a Dean Discussion featuring economic theorist Jeremy Rifkin on Wednesday, February 6, 2019 at the Moss Arts Center.

Influential economic theorist, Jeremy Rifkin, will visit Virginia Tech for a lecture addressing key global challenges and the benefits of potentially shifting the Roanoke and New River Valleys into the next Industrial Age. President Tim sands will provide feedback from the perspective of Virginia Tech.

Jeremy Rifkin is the author of 20 books on the impact of scientific and technological changes on the global economy and the environment. His most recent works include "The Zero Marginal Cost Society" (2014), "The Third Industrial Revolution" (2011), "The Empathic Civilization" (2010), and "The European Dream" (2004).

Rifkin has been an advisor to the European Union since 2000 and has counseled the three most recent presidents of the European Commission. In addition, he has served as an advisor to the leadership of the European Parliament and prominent European heads of state on issues related to the economy, climate change, and energy security. Most recently, he has advised the leadership of the People’s Republic of China on similar topics.

Since 1995, Rifkin has taught at the Wharton School of the University of Pennsylvania where he instructs corporate CEOs and senior business managers on how to transition business operations into sustainable economies.

In 2015, Rifkin was listed among the top 10 most influential economic thinkers in the WorldPost/HuffingtonPost survey of “the world’s most influential voices.”
